A Washington, D.C. native, Mya burst onto the scene in 1998 with her double-platinum, self-titled debut album, Mya, establishing herself as a defining voice in late-’90s and early-2000s R&B and pop. The album introduced major hits including “It’s All About Me,” “Movin’ On,” and “My First Night With You,” followed by continued success with her sophomore album, Fear of Flying, featuring the signature hit “Case of the Ex.” In 2001, Mya reached new heights as part of the all-star collaboration “Lady Marmalade,” which topped charts worldwide and earned a Grammy Award.
Mya continued to evolve artistically with her third album, Moodring, highlighted by singles such as “My Love Is Like… Wo” and “Fallen,” while expanding her presence in film and television with roles in Chicago, Shall We Dance, and an acclaimed run on Dancing with the Stars. As part of the ensemble cast of Chicago, Mya earned a Screen Actors Guild Award, further cementing her status as a versatile entertainer across music, film, television, and live performance.
In 2008, Mya launched her independent label, Planet 9, becoming a pioneer of artist independence as she wrote, produced, and released a steady stream of projects on her own terms. Her independent catalog includes K.I.S.S., Smoove Jones, T.K.O. (The Knock Out), and her latest studio album, RETROSPECT. Smoove Jones earned a Grammy nomination for Best R&B Album, underscoring her continued creative excellence beyond the major-label system.
Beyond music, Mya is a dedicated philanthropist and entrepreneur. She founded The Mya Arts & Tech Foundation to support youth education in the arts and technology and has remained actively involved in causes ranging from breast cancer awareness to animal welfare and global humanitarian efforts. With a career spanning more than two decades, she continues to release new music, tour internationally, and inspire fans with her enduring artistry, versatility, and purpose-driven work.

Afroman’s musical career began in the eighth grade, when he began recording homemade songs and selling them to his classmates. “The first tape I made was about my eighth-grade teacher,” he once recalled. “She got me kicked out of school for sagging my pants, which was a big deal back then. So I wrote this song about her and it sold about 400 copies: it was selling to teachers, students, just about everybody. And I realized that, even though I wasn’t at school, my song was at school, so in a way I was still there. All these people would come by my house just to give me comments about how cool they thought the song was.” Foreman also performed in his church at a young age, playing both the drums and guitar.
In 1998, Afroman released his first album, My Fro-losophy and later relocated to Hattiesburg, Mississippi, where he met drummer Jody Stallone, keyboardist/bassist Darrell Havard and producer Tim Ramenofsky (a.k.a. Headfridge).
Ramenofsky produced and released Afroman’s album Because I Got High in 2000 on T-Bones Records; it was distributed primarily through concerts and the file-sharing service Napster before its title track was played on The Howard Stern Show. Afroman was inspired to write the song’s lyrical content by his unwillingness to clean his room, and he ran with the idea of everyday tasks being derailed by drug use. In late 2001, the song became a hit and was featured in the films Jay and Silent Bob Strike Back, The Perfect Score, and Disturbia later in the 2000s. Because I Got High was nominated for the Grammy Award for “Best Rap Solo Performance” in 2002.
After the single’s success, Afroman joined the lineup of Cypress Hill’s fall festival Smoke Out with the Deftones, Method Man, and others. After this, Universal Records signed Afroman to a six-album deal, and Universal released The Good Times in 2001. The Good Times was a compilation of Afroman’s first two albums and some new tracks.
Afroman started releasing his music independently and mostly through the Internet in 2004, and that year, he recorded Jobe Bells, which satirized traditional Christmas songs.
Afroman was part of the 2010 Gathering of the Juggalos lineup.
In October 2014, Afroman released a remix of his hit song Because I Got High in order to highlight the usefulness of marijuana as part of the effort to legalize its sale across the United States.
In January of 2021, Afroman signed with revolutionary record label, Cosmic Wire. Owned and operated by artist/producer BLAZAR (Jerad Finck), and growth hacking expert BJ Klock, their first single “WHOLEthing” was released as a precursor to his upcoming album release.
